Dr James Earle and his wife live in comfortable seclusion near the Hog's Back, a ridge in the North Downs in the beautiful Surrey countryside. When Dr Earle disappears from his cottage, Inspector French is called in to investigate. At first he suspects a simple domestic intrigue - and begins to uncover a web of romantic entanglements beneath the couple's peaceful rural life. The case soon takes a more complex turn. Other people vanish mysteriously, one of Dr Earle's house guests among them. What is the explanation for the disappearances? If the missing people have been murdered, what can be the motive? This fiendishly complicated puzzle is one that only Inspector French can solve. Freeman Wills Crofts was a master of the intricately and ingeniously plotted detective novel, and The Hog's Back Mystery shows him at the height of his powers.

The novel is incredibly enjoyable. More than that, Crofts has successfully circumvented the common criticism of the detective novel, in that none of his characters feel two-dimensional. He has combined wit, verve, and interesting characters with a thorough, involving mystery plot it s a real treat of a novel. --Shiny New Books
With this early example of a police procedural, Freeman Wills Croft set a high standard for his successors.... For readers who relish trying to beat the author at his own game, clues pointing to the solution are neatly paced throughout the narrative. The result is an engaging brain teaser perfect for armchair relaxation. --Daily Mail
Freeman Wills Crofts (1879 - 1957) was one of the pre-eminent writers in the golden age of British crime fiction. He was the author of more than thirty detective novels and was greatly admired by his peers, including Agatha Christie and Raymond Chandler.
